WebApr 13, 2024 · After Paul talked to them, the Jews left and had long discussions about what Paul had told them. For two years, Paul lived in his own house, he was allowed to hire people to live in the house with him, but he was still a prisoner. People came to his house to listen to his instruction about Jesus.

WebFor the two years Paul was in Rome he was allowed to live in his own rented house with Roman guards keeping an eye on him. While there he often invited the Jews to come to his house and hear about Jesus. Some of the Jews became Christians. Paul also spent time writing epistles (letters) to the churches he had visited.
